Rev 13:11
¶ Then I saw
1
another beast rising up out of the earth; he had two horns like a lamb and he spoke like a dragon. [Matt 7:15, 16]

721b
arnion
; dim. from
704; a little lamb:--
Lamb(27), lamb(1), Lamb's(1), lambs(1).
1093
gê
; a prim. word;
the earth, land:--
country(2), earth(165), earthly(1), ground(20), land(46), soil(16).
1404
drakôn
; from an alt. form of
derkomai
(to look); a dragon
(a mythical monster):--dragon(13).
